Deterioration of Graininess in Halftone Areas

Cause:
This may occur if:
Printing is performed after the machine is left idle for a while.
Printing is done at high temperature or humidity
Documents with a small image area are printed continuously.
The developer’s electrostatic property diminishes, causing the toner adhesion to increase. If this happens, the shapes of half-tone image dots may be degraded and luster (dot height) may be uneven.
Solution:
In the [Machine: Maintenance] group on the [Operator Adjust.] menu, execute 0506: [Execute Developer Refreshing].
Print the image. Has the problem been resolved?
Yes | Finished! |
No | Go to the next step. |
Set the value of halftone screen frequency in the print setting to "175" or "200".
Print the image. Has the problem been resolved?
Yes | Finished! |
No | No further improvement is likely. Contact your service representative. |
